排序
在Node.js環境中使用request庫獲取網頁內容時,為什么會出現編碼異常?如何解決?
Node.js中使用request庫爬取網頁時出現編碼異常的解決方法 在使用Node.js的request庫進行網頁抓取時,經常會遇到編碼問題導致返回內容亂碼的情況。本文將詳細分析問題原因并提供解決方案。 問題...
Linux環境下Node.js日志安全如何保障
本文介紹在Linux系統中如何確保Node.js應用日志安全。 以下策略能有效提升日志安全性及可管理性: 選擇安全的日志庫: 采用成熟的日志庫,例如winston或morgan,記錄服務器所有活動,包括請求、...
Vue.js 如何實現動態組件切換
在 vue.js 中實現動態組件切換可以通過以下步驟實現:1. 使用 元素和 is 屬性來動態渲染組件。2. 通過改變數據來切換組件,如 currentcomponent。3. 使用 keep-alive 指令來緩存組件狀態,提升...
利用PhpStorm進行Node.js后端開發的實踐
利用phpstorm進行node.js后端開發非常高效。phpstorm支持node.js運行時、npm、調試工具,提供智能代碼補全、錯誤提示、代碼重構、版本控制和測試框架,幫助優化性能。 利用PhpStorm進行Node.js...
MongoDB如何實現讀寫分離 讀寫分離配置減輕主庫壓力
mongodb實現讀寫分離主要依賴于副本集配置。1. 配置副本集,通過主節點處理寫操作并復制到多個從節點;2. 設置讀偏好(如primary、secondary等)決定讀操作分發策略;3. 使用寫關注和讀關注機制...
VSCode終端字體顯示異常怎么辦?VSCode終端樣式調整方法
vscode終端字體發虛可通過調整渲染設置、更換字體、禁用抗鋸齒、調整縮放比例、更新驅動等方法解決。首先,嘗試將renderertype從auto改為canvas或dom;其次,更換為consolas、fira code或jetbra...
Debian Node.js 日志中的錯誤碼含義解析
在 debian 系統上使用 node.js 時,日志中的錯誤碼可以幫助開發者快速定位和解決問題。以下是一些常見的 node.js 錯誤碼及其含義: EPERM:操作不被允許。這通常是由于權限問題,例如嘗試創建日...
前端開發中如何實現類似 VSCode 的面板拖拽調整功能?
前端實現 VSCode 風格面板拖拽調整 許多開發者希望在前端項目中復制 VSCode 的靈活面板拖拽功能,從而提升用戶體驗。VSCode 允許用戶自由拖拽調整面板大小和位置,極大提高效率。本文探討如何在...
js中如何用對象替代多個if判斷
使用對象替代多個if判斷的核心答案是通過構建映射對象實現條件與操作的對應關系,從而提升代碼可讀性和維護性。具體步驟如下:1. 創建映射對象,鍵為條件,值為對應的執行函數;2. 使用變量或表...
Atomic CSS框架(如Tailwind)為何需要配合@apply使用?濫用會導致哪些問題?
atomic css框架如tailwind提供@apply指令并不矛盾,而是為了在保持原子化優勢的同時實現樣式復用。①@apply解決復雜組件中類名冗余問題,提高代碼可維護性;②濫用會導致樣式耦合、css體積增大...